What is a Mathematics Festival?  A CMC Mathematics Festival is anexciting school wide event to expose students, teachers, and parents tokey critical mathematics topics in a positive, self exploratory,festival-like atmosphere.  The Mathematics Festival program isdesigned for ready access to Kindergarten through 8th grade studentswith activities and challenges appropriate for ALL those grades. A CMC Math Festival is good mathematics, Standards based, ANDFUN!


f03girlsMIRA: Standards Based!

Your students can experience the Standards first-hand at aMath Festival.  Each of the three CMC Mathematics Festivalsconsists of 12 to 18 different problem solving activity stations, eachfocusing on one or more key mathconcepts from the California Mathematics Standards.  Each Stationhas 12 to 16 different math tasks to meet all students’ abilities andskills, K~8.






There are currently 3 different Math Festivals to choose from:

 
• ALGEBRA

• GEOMETRY

• NUMBER



hands-on for K~8 Grades!
Math Festival stations are multi-graded and highly interactive. Atstations students use everything from blocks and beans to laptopcomputersto solve tasks.  For instance at one station students makealgebraic function patterns out of CUBES, while at another station theysolve simultaneous equations with two unknowns using BEANS.  Eachstation offers challenging tasks of differing levels of difficulty;some are easy enough for young primary students; some are hard enoughto challenge adults.  During a session, students working in pairscan solve many problems and visit many Math Festival stations.

Curriculum Materials!
Everyschool that hosts a Math Festival receives a complete set ofthe Festival's printed curriculum materials based upon thatFestival's topic. There are three CMC Math Festivals: Algebra,Geometry, and Number, and each has it's own completely different MathFestival curriculum. These Math Festival materials are designed to helpyour school extend the learningand excitement of your Math Festival day—all year long! Theprinted Festival materials consist of photocopies of the MathFestival station instruction posters for each activity; Spanishtranslations of the instructions;photocopies of EVERY task for every Math Festival station (average 12different problem solving tasks per station); lists ofmanipulatives and materials needed for each station; and answers tomost ofthe station's problems. We encourage your teachers to use of thesematerials in creative ways. With these printed materials your schoolcould even host YOUR OWN Math Festival, and several schools have doneso!
